sean sold 4 more boxes of candy for the school fundraiser than Chris. The sum of the boxes that they sold was 22

Set up an equation.
x+x+4=22
the varibles x are the unknown number of boxes. the first x is Chris amount and the second is Seans amount.
Isolate the variable:
x+x+4=22
2x+4=22
2x=18
x=9
Chris has 9 boxes.
Add 4 to the variable to get Seans amount:
9+4=13
Sean has 13 boxes
To check your answer add the results together to get the correct sum.
9+13=22
